Output 10808e86fe624e6277b15510e569ab06e2327cdcc54d2392f31ae01fcaeb9484:0
- value
- 155089537
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5f096d0c99f188da05be0c7b7fba02314d99286 OP_EQUAL
- address
- 3Nepsu42dyJ3AaZ2mkNEvAhTEBBUbvcQST
- transaction
- 10808e86fe624e6277b15510e569ab06e2327cdcc54d2392f31ae01fcaeb9484
- confirmations
- 321898
- spent
- true